3) Luau Night! Turn your backyard into a luau party! Decorate your table with lights (even Christmas lights will do!) and inexpensive luau party supplies from your local party center. Pick up some pulled pork, sushi, and fresh fruit salads. Or try these pork and pineapple kabobs for the grill. Find a luau station on Pandora. Bust out the broomstick and do the limbo. Chances are – everyone will have a great time!
4) Water fun! Spend the day by a pool or a lake. Bust out the sprinklers and water guns. Go to a waterpark. Or just fill a bucket with water.
